Exploring the Significance of Whey Protein in Nutrition

<a href="https://limitsofstrategy.com/whey-protein-isolate-discover-its-key-benefits/">Whey protein</a> stands out as a premium source of protein derived from milk during the cheese-making process. It is highly regarded for its comprehensive amino acid profile, containing all nine essential amino acids that are crucial for numerous bodily functions. This quality makes whey protein particularly advantageous for athletes and fitness enthusiasts focused on enhancing muscle growth and recovery. Its rapid digestion rate sets it apart from other protein sources, facilitating quick access to essential nutrients needed post-exercise.

Diving into the Various Types of Whey Protein Available
Whey protein comes in three primary forms: concentrate, isolate, and hydrolysate, each with unique properties regarding protein concentration, lactose content, and absorption rates, catering to varying dietary preferences and requirements. Whey protein concentrate (WPC) typically contains around 70-80% protein along with some fats and carbohydrates, making it an appealing option for those seeking a flavorful, natural protein source. In contrast, whey protein isolate (WPI) features a protein concentration exceeding 90%, with most fats and lactose eliminated, making it ideal for individuals with lactose intolerance or those aiming to cut down on calorie intake.
Whey protein hydrolysate (WPH) is pre-digested, allowing for faster absorption and is often utilized in medical protein supplements and infant formulas. Each type provides distinct advantages, and selecting the appropriate one hinges on personal health objectives, dietary limitations, and taste preferences. Gaining an understanding of these distinctions empowers consumers to make educated decisions regarding the effective incorporation of whey protein into their diets.

Exploring the Broader Health Benefits of Whey Protein
Beyond its role in muscle development, whey protein presents a multitude of health benefits. Research indicates that it can enhance immune function, likely due to its rich composition of immunoglobulins and lactoferrin, which play crucial roles in the immune response. Regular consumption of whey protein may strengthen the body’s defenses against infections and illnesses, making it a valuable dietary addition for those striving for optimal health.
Moreover, whey protein can assist in weight management by promoting feelings of fullness. This satiety can lead to decreased caloric intake, as individuals feel satisfied for extended periods. The Role of Whey Protein in Stimulating Muscle Growth
The high concentration of leucine in whey protein is vital for initiating muscle protein synthesis, a fundamental process for muscle growth and recovery following exercise. This property makes whey protein an ideal supplement for athletes and fitness enthusiasts looking to increase muscle mass and strength. After workouts, the body requires protein to repair muscle fibers stressed during intense physical activity; whey protein supplies this essential nutrient rapidly due to its quick absorption rate.
Research has shown that supplementing with whey protein post-exercise can result in significant gains in muscle strength and size, particularly when combined with resistance training. Whey Protein’s Impact on Immune Health
The immune-boosting properties of whey protein can profoundly enhance overall health. Rich in immunoglobulins and cysteine, whey protein fortifies immune function and aids in the production of glutathione, a key antioxidant for cellular health. Incorporating whey protein into the diet may strengthen the body’s ability to fend off infections and improve immune health.

Common Side Effects Associated with Whey Protein Consumption
While most individuals can safely consume whey protein, some may encounter digestive issues, such as bloating or gas, particularly if they are lactose intolerant. This is particularly pertinent for those who choose whey protein concentrate, which contains higher levels of lactose compared to isolate forms. Individuals with lactose intolerance should consider whey protein isolate, which undergoes processing to eliminate most lactose, providing a gentler alternative.
It is essential for consumers to be mindful of their body’s responses to whey protein and adjust their intake accordingly. Starting with smaller servings and gradually increasing them can aid individuals in determining their tolerance levels. Is Whey Protein Suitable for Everyone? Key Considerations
While whey protein is generally safe for most individuals, it may not be suitable for those with milk allergies or specific health conditions. Individuals with dairy allergies should avoid whey protein entirely, as it can provoke allergic reactions. Additionally, people with existing kidney issues should consult a healthcare provider before incorporating high-protein supplements into their diets, as excessive protein may place strain on the kidneys.

How Does Whey Protein Differ from Casein?
Whey protein is a fast-digesting protein that allows for quick nutrient absorption post-exercise, while casein is a slow-digesting protein that delivers a sustained release of amino acids over time.
Is Whey Protein Safe for Those with Lactose Intolerance?
Yes, individuals with lactose intolerance can choose whey protein isolate, which contains lower lactose levels, making it easier to digest.
